173. Three Neapolitan dishes, Real Fabbrica Ferdinandea, from the Service del Fiordalisi, circa 1792-95
Three Naples, Real Fabbrica Ferdinandea, plates from the Servizio del Fiordalisi, circa 1792-95
Each painted with a circular topographical medallion, two titled in iron-red on the reverse, depicting 'Veduta del Molo di Napoli', 'Tempio delgi Giganti a Pozzuoli', the third with an untitled view depicting figures viewing the coast from a height, within gilt foliate borders, a band of gilt and blue cornflower sprigs between gilt bands to the brown-edged rim, 24cm across, one with crowned N mark in underglaze-blue (one with haircrack to rim, another slightly worn) (3)
Provenance
Italian Private Collection
